AI Summary

  • Expands the definition of "daycare" to include facilities that are licensed OR zoned, permitted, or approved by a city or county for use as a daycare, rather than only licensed daycares

  • Registered sex offenders are prohibited from being on school or daycare premises, loitering within 500 feet, using school/daycare transportation, or residing within 500 feet of these properties when children under 18 are present

  • Exceptions allow registered sex offenders to access school/daycare grounds for voting, mail pickup, dropping off/picking up their own children, attending school events for their children, or making deliveries—with prior written permission required annually

  • Technical corrections replace outdated language ("upon" to "on," "under" to "pursuant to," "the age of" to "of age," "child" to "child's")

  • Declared an emergency measure with an effective date of July 1, 2026
